The Rise of digital Torque Wrenches: Revolutionizing Precision and Efficiency

  • Introduction
  • In the realm of industrial manufacturing and maintenance, precision is paramount. Torque, the rotational force applied to an object, plays a critical role in ensuring the integrity of assemblies, from automotive engines to aerospace components. Traditional torque wrenches, while effective, often suffer from limitations in accuracy, data recording, and user-friendliness. Enter the digital torque wrench – a technological marvel that is revolutionizing the way torque is measured and applied.

  • What is a Digital Torque Wrench?

    A digital torque wrench is a sophisticated tool that incorporates advanced electronics and sensors to measure and control applied torque. Unlike their analog counterparts, these wrenches provide real-time, accurate readings displayed on a digital screen. This instantaneous feedback allows for precise adjustments and minimizes the risk of over-tightening or under-tightening fasteners, which can lead to component failure and costly repairs.

  • Key Features and Benefits
  • Enhanced Accuracy: Digital torque wrenches boast exceptional accuracy, often surpassing the capabilities of traditional tools. This precision is crucial in industries where even minor deviations in torque can have significant consequences.

  • Real-time Feedback: The real-time display of torque values enables operators to make immediate adjustments, ensuring that the desired torque is achieved consistently. This eliminates the guesswork and reduces the potential for human error.
  • Data Logging and Analysis: Many digital torque wrenches are equipped with data logging capabilities. This allows for the recording of torque values for each fastener, creating a comprehensive audit trail. This data can be analyzed to identify trends, optimize tightening procedures, and improve overall process efficiency.
  • Improved Ergonomics: Digital torque wrenches are often designed with ergonomics in mind, featuring lightweight and balanced designs that reduce operator fatigue. Some models even incorporate features like adjustable handles and backlit displays to enhance user comfort and visibility.
  • Versatility: Digital torque wrenches are available in a wide range of models, each designed for specific applications and torque ranges. This versatility makes them suitable for a diverse array of industries, including automotive manufacturing, aerospace, heavy equipment, and more.
  • Reduced Costs: While the initial investment in a digital torque wrench may be higher than that of a traditional tool, the long-term benefits can significantly outweigh the cost. Improved accuracy, reduced rework, and increased efficiency can lead to substantial cost savings.
  • Enhanced Safety: By eliminating the risk of over-tightening, digital torque wrenches contribute to a safer working environment. This is particularly important in industries where over-tightened fasteners can lead to component failure and potential injuries.

  • Types of Digital Torque Wrenches

    Digital torque wrenches come in various types, each with its own unique features and applications:

    Click-type Wrenches: These wrenches provide a distinct audible or tactile click when the target torque is reached. They are often preferred for their simplicity and ease of use.

  • Transducer Wrenches: These wrenches utilize strain gauges or other sensors to measure the applied torque. They offer high accuracy and are suitable for a wide range of applications.
  • Electronic Wrenches: These wrenches incorporate advanced electronics and microprocessors to control and monitor torque. They often feature data logging capabilities and can be integrated with other devices, such as computers and tablets.
  • Battery-powered Wrenches: These wrenches are powered by rechargeable batteries, providing greater flexibility and convenience compared to corded models.

  • Applications of Digital Torque Wrenches
  • Digital torque wrenches find applications in a wide range of industries, including:

    Automotive Manufacturing: Ensuring proper torque on critical fasteners, such as engine bolts, wheel nuts, and suspension components.

  • Aerospace Manufacturing: Tightening aircraft components with extreme precision to ensure flight safety and structural integrity.
  • Heavy Equipment Manufacturing: Assembling heavy machinery and ensuring the proper torque on critical joints and connections.
  • Maintenance and Repair: Performing maintenance and repair operations on various equipment, including vehicles, machinery, and industrial equipment.
  • Research and Development: Conducting research and development activities that require precise torque control.
